We also visited an authentic Dutch windmill that was given to America after WWII for her help to the Allies. Part of the deal was that the mill must be in use... so they have a miller there who was trained in Holland, and they produce flour that you can buy. The other part of the deal was that the mill must be used for educational purposes... so we all got a tour. It was neat!
